Discussion: Finance and the Healthcare Manager
The healthcare industry is facing significant financial challenges, and healthcare managers must be equipped with the knowledge and skills to make sound financial decisions to address these challenges. One of the individuals described in the Good Samaritan Hospital’s Organizational Chart is the Director of Finance, whose role is to oversee the financial operations of the hospital.
A potential financial situation faced by the Director of Finance is a decline in reimbursements from insurance companies or the government. This situation is a challenge because it directly impacts the hospital’s revenue and profitability. The Director of Finance must work with the hospital’s billing and coding department to ensure accurate and timely submission of claims to insurance companies and government programs to maximize reimbursements.
To successfully apply the principles of financial management, the Director of Finance can use financial analysis tools to assess the hospital’s financial condition regularly. By analyzing financial reports, the Director of Finance can identify areas of financial inefficiency and develop strategies to address them. Additionally, the Director of Finance can work with other healthcare managers to implement cost-saving measures, such as reducing unnecessary expenses and improving the efficiency of hospital operations.
The healthcare setting plays a crucial role in the application of financial management principles. Healthcare managers must be familiar with the unique financial challenges faced by their organization and the industry as a whole. They must also understand the impact of regulatory changes, such as changes in reimbursement rates or changes in healthcare policies, on the financial condition of their organization. By staying up-to-date with financial trends and regulations, healthcare managers can make informed decisions to improve their organization’s financial performance.
